Output 332602736ae17dad3d6d5059a00c352e181cdd97434015f035cd4c5c2b9cee27:103

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8e2c848d1a42f8465f4a37233ad633574e5efa48066a8c5f6ee867e9b8faf17
address
bc1par3vsjx35shcge055der8ttrx46wtmayspn2330ka6r8axu04utsjv0c6m
transaction
332602736ae17dad3d6d5059a00c352e181cdd97434015f035cd4c5c2b9cee27
spent
true